The Adolescent Housing Hub (AHH or the Hub) is a real-time database designed to assist youth with placement in a transitional or permanent housing program.

AHH is managed by the Office of Housing under the Department of Children and Families. AHH services are available to eligible homeless youth, youth at risk for homelessness, and youth aging out of the child welfare system, ages 18 – 21 years.

If you or a loved one has a disability, sign up for New Jersey Office of Emergency Management's Register Ready program.

It helps connect people who require specific accommodations with first responders during an emergency.

We can all play a role in helping to prevent su***de. One way to prepare is to learn the warning signs, which may include changes in mood, sleep, or behavior; withdrawing from others; or talking about having no reason to live. NJ Department of Human Services’ Division of Mental Health and Addiction Services connects you to multiple hotlines & helplines which provide phone help, counseling, crisis intervention, addiction support and resources to individuals needing emergency assistance.
